I was delighted to welcome the new Routemaster, or Boris Bus as they will inevitably be known, to Golders Green. The new bus will replace Ken Livingstone’s hated giant bendy-buses – now completely banished from the capital, as promised by Boris.
Golders Green was one of the last places to lose the original Routemaster and I know will enthusiastically welcome it back in its new modern form. Scrapping bendy-buses has saved some £7m as they were notorious for fare dodging. In contrast the new Boris Bus will suited to Barnet’s roads, environmentally friendly and when a conductor is on board passengers will be again able to hop on and off using the rear open platform.
